My Approach as a Guitar Teacher

Teaching Method and Techniques

My teaching philosophy is based on hands-on learning, creativity, and personalization. Playing the guitar should be both fun and structured, so I tailor lessons to each student’s skill level, musical interests, and goals.

I incorporate a mix of:
• Fundamentals & Technique – Proper hand positioning, picking, fretting, and strumming patterns.
• Music Theory – Scales, chords, progressions, and how they apply to real music.
• Song-Based Learning – Teaching techniques and theory through songs the student enjoys.
• Ear Training & Improvisation – Developing musical intuition and creativity.
• Practice Strategies – Effective exercises to improve speed, accuracy, and muscle memory.

A Typical Lesson

A lesson usually begins with warm-up exercises to build finger strength and dexterity. We then focus on a specific skill, such as chord transitions, strumming patterns, or lead techniques, applying them to a song or musical piece. Depending on the student’s goals, we might explore improvisation, songwriting, or music theory. Each session ends with a recap, practice tips, and setting goals for the next lesson.
